The Mundelein Mustangs will face off against the Jacobs Golden Eagles at 4:45 p.m. on Tuesday. Mundelein is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 9.2 runs per game this season.

On Monday, Mundelein got the win against Waukegan by a conclusive 17-2. The Mustangs haven't had any issues with the Bulldogs recently, as the game was their seventh consecutive victory against them.

Mundelein got a massive performance out of Kieley Tomas, who got on base in three of her four plate appearances with three runs, one triple, and one stolen base. The team also got some help courtesy of Emily Courtney, who went 1-for-3 with four RBI, one stolen base, and one run.

Mundelein always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.636. The last time their OBP was this high was back in April.

Meanwhile, Jacobs hadn't done well against Antioch recently (they were 0-5 in their previous five mat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Monday. The Golden Eagles had just enough and edged out the Sequoits 4-3.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est win the Golden Eagles have posted since April 29th.

Taylor Schweet looked comfortable as she pitched 3.1 innings while giving up no earned runs or hits. She has been nothing but reliable on the mound: she hasn't given up more than one earned run in three consecutive appearances.

On the hitting side, the team relied heavily on Avarie Lohrmann, who went a perfect 3-for-3 with one stolen base, one run, and one double. Those three hits gave her a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Audrey Wetzel, who went 3-for-4 with one run and one double.

Jacobs' victory ended a four-game drought on the road and puts them at 17-16. As for Mundelein, their win bumped their record up to 18-8.

Jacobs' pitching crew has a crucial task ahead of them: Mundelein has hit smart this season, having averaged an OBP of .448. It's a different story for Jacobs, though, as they've only averaged .363.
